Explore the application of integer linear programming (ILP) techniques to solve complex computational biology problems in this 29-minute conference talk. Learn how mathematical optimization methods can be applied to biological data analysis, including sequence alignment, phylogenetic reconstruction, and genomic assembly challenges. Discover the fundamental principles of ILP formulation for biological problems, understand when and why integer constraints are necessary in computational biology applications, and examine real-world case studies where ILP has provided elegant solutions to previously intractable biological questions. Gain insights into the computational complexity considerations, solver selection strategies, and practical implementation approaches for incorporating ILP into your computational biology toolkit.
